CONSTRUCTION ACCIDENT STATISTICS
According to a 2019 report issued by Colorado’s Department of Public Health & Environment, there were 19 fatalities in the construction industry in 2017, with 12 fatalities in 2016. Further, the Bureau of Labor Statistics reported about 195,600 construction-related injuries in 2018. The construction industry was the sixth-highest industry for workplace injuries. In 2018, the rate of construction site accidents was about three cases per 100 full-time workers.
